The Butterfly Speaks


Observe the busy blue butterfly, using no words, can you not hear her speak?
like flowers, she blossoms, she is beautiful and her bearing is meek.

Kitty eavesdrops as nature translates, like a magnet, their shared joys attract;
butterflies and kittens, are soul mates; just by being, their lives interact.

Kittens' antics express delight and freedom; butterflies inspire without contact.  
Lessons learned from these jewels, might we poets freely live with such impact?

Drawing wisdom from nature's critters who have a Creator they can trust;
might we too seek His inspiration?  Humbly recalling He made us from dust
